trust ipv6-diffserv
c e s
Allows the dynamic classification of IPv6 DSCP.
Syntax
trust ipv6-diffserv
To remove the definition, use the no trust ipv6-diffserv command.
Defaults
This command has no default behavior or values.
Table 26-1. show ipv6 route Command Example Fields
Field Description
(undefined) Identifies the type of route:
L = Local
C = connected
S = static
R = RIP
B = BGP
IN = internal BGP
EX = external BGP
LO = Locally Originated
O = OSPF
IA = OSPF inter area
N1 = OSPF NSSA external type 1
N2 = OSPF NSSA external type 2
E1 = OSPF external type 1
E2 = OSPF external type 2
i = IS-IS
L1 = IS-IS level-1
L2 = IS-IS level-2
IA = IS-IS inter-area
* = candidate default
> = non-active route
+ = summary routes
Destination Identifies the route’s destination IPv6 address.
Gateway Identifies whether the route is directly connected and on which interface the route
is configured.
Dist/Metric Identifies if the route has a specified distance or metric.
Last Change Identifies when the route was last changed or configured.
